[+] iptables - pisanie regu
RaV., spokojnie, no przeciez nie oczekuje ze mi ktos przysle skrypt itp. Po prostu wydawalo mi sie, ze powinien byc jakis sposob w takim stylu jak dopisywanie roznych rzeczy do /etc/network/interfaces dlatego pytalem o pomoc. Ze skrypem sobie juz poradze - nie czekam na gotowe rozwiazania.
Pozdrawiam i dziekuje wszystkim za pomoc :-)
Pozdrawiam i dziekuje wszystkim za pomoc :-)
Spokojniesiwuch86 pisze:RaV., spokojnie, no przeciez nie oczekuje ze mi ktos przysle skrypt itp. Po prostu wydawalo mi sie, ze powinien byc jakis sposob w takim stylu jak dopisywanie roznych rzeczy do /etc/network/interfaces dlatego pytalem o pomoc.

Fajnie, że wspomniałeś o pliku /etc/network/interfaces. Zajrzyj do manuala
Kod: Zaznacz cały
man interfaces
RaV. wlasnie caly problem w tym ze tak nie dziala. Działa tylko gdy recznie klade/podnosze interfejs (ifdown/ifup). A w przypadku jak np. wypne kabel z modemu to z punktu widzenia ifupdown interfejs jest caly czas podniesiony i po wpieciu kabla spowrotem dostaje nowy adres ip ale plik /etc/network/interfaces nie jest w ogole przetwarzany no i nic z tego :/
Tak wyglada wpis w interfaces:
Test:
Tak wyglada wpis w interfaces:
Kod: Zaznacz cały
auto ppp0
iface ppp0 inet ppp
provider neostrada
post-up touch /home/siwuch/plik
Kod: Zaznacz cały
# ls | grep plik <- na poczatku niema pliku "plik"
# ifdown ppp0
# ifup ppp0
Plugin pppoatm.so loaded.
# ls | grep plik <- plik jest wiec dziala jak trzeba
plik
# rm plik <- kolejny test - usuwam plik
# ls | grep plik
################### Wypinam kabel z modemu ######################
# ifconfig |grep ppp0 <- wyjscie ifconfig nie pokazuje ppp0 - int padl
################### Podłączam kabel #########################
# ifconfig |grep ppp0
ppp0 Link encap:Point-to-Point Protocol <- int sie podniosl
# ls | grep plik <- pliku niema :/